gi-docgen (2023.1+ds-5) unstable; urgency=high

  * d/p/debian/utils-Search-usr-lib-MULTIARCH-gir-1.0.patch:
    Add missing import to fix invocation outside package build context
    (regression in 2023.1+ds-4, Closes: #1056185)

 -- Simon McVittie <smcv@debian.org>  Sat, 18 Nov 2023 14:47:18 +0000

gi-docgen (2023.1+ds-4) unstable; urgency=medium

  [ Simon McVittie ]
  * d/rules: Stop forcing DEB_PYTHON_INSTALL_LAYOUT.
    This is no longer necessary with debhelper (>= 13.11.5).
  * d/p/debian/Disable-web-fonts-for-now.patch:
    Move non-upstreamable patch into d/p/debian/
  * d/p/utils-Search-for-GIR-XML-in-GI_GIR_PATH.patch,
    d/p/test-Assert-that-GIR_GIR_PATH-is-respected.patch,
    d/p/utils-Always-fall-back-to-usr-share-gir-1.0-on-Unix.patch:
    Add proposed patches to find GIR XML in $GI_GIR_PATH and
    /usr/share/gir-1.0, matching GObject-Introspection 1.78.x
  * d/p/debian/utils-Search-usr-lib-MULTIARCH-gir-1.0.patch:
    Add Debian-specific patch to search /usr/lib/MULTIARCH/gir-1.0.
    This is a prerequisite for changing gobject-introspection to install
    a subset of GIR XML into /usr/lib/MULTIARCH. (Helps: #1029957)
  * d/control: Stop generating from d/control.in

  [ Amin Bandali ]
  * Change packaging branch to debian/latest

 -- Simon McVittie <smcv@debian.org>  Sat, 11 Nov 2023 14:50:52 +0000

gi-docgen (2023.1+ds-3) unstable; urgency=medium

  * Avoid trying to install into /usr/local with newer Meson.
    Mitigates: #1041537
  * Remove version constraints unnecessary since Debian 11

 -- Simon McVittie <smcv@debian.org>  Wed, 26 Jul 2023 11:35:40 +0100

gi-docgen (2023.1+ds-2) unstable; urgency=medium

  * debian/control.in: Require Python >= 3.11 and drop python3-toml dependency
  * debian/control.in: Build-Depend on dh-python >= 5.20230130~
  * Update standards version to 4.6.2, no changes needed

 -- Jeremy Bicha <jbicha@ubuntu.com>  Mon, 30 Jan 2023 14:08:14 -0500

gi-docgen (2023.1+ds-1) unstable; urgency=medium

  [ Jeremy Bicha ]
  * New upstream release

  [ Debian Janitor ]
  * Apply multi-arch hints. + gi-docgen-doc: Add Multi-Arch: foreign

 -- Jeremy Bicha <jbicha@ubuntu.com>  Mon, 09 Jan 2023 18:27:48 -0500

gi-docgen (2022.2+ds-1) unstable; urgency=medium

  * New upstream release
  * d/copyright: Update
  * d/control.in: Update dependency on python3-markdown
  * d/p/templates-Remove-html5shiv.patch:
    Drop patch, an equivalent change was made upstream
  * d/p/Disable-web-fonts-for-now.patch:
    Refresh patch
  * Standards-Version: 4.6.1 (no changes required)

 -- Simon McVittie <smcv@debian.org>  Sat, 12 Nov 2022 17:22:35 +0000

gi-docgen (2022.1+ds-1) unstable; urgency=medium

  * New upstream release
  * d/copyright: Update
  * Refresh patch series

 -- Simon McVittie <smcv@debian.org>  Wed, 16 Feb 2022 10:29:15 +0000

gi-docgen (2021.8+ds1-2) unstable; urgency=medium

  * d/control.in: Adjust Description.
    The Description assumed that all packages that depend on gi-docgen will
    vendor a copy, but libportal does not (which will have a higher
    regression risk until gi-docgen is stable).
  * Standards-Version: 4.6.0 (no changes required)
  * Upload to unstable, required for libportal 0.5 transition (#1003085)

 -- Simon McVittie <smcv@debian.org>  Wed, 05 Jan 2022 09:52:37 +0000

gi-docgen (2021.8+ds1-1) experimental; urgency=medium

  * New upstream release
    - Refresh patch series
    - The new upstream release now ships meson_options.txt, remove
      the workaround with d/missing/meson_options.txt
  * d/copyright: Update

 -- Simon McVittie <smcv@debian.org>  Sun, 31 Oct 2021 20:49:13 +0000

gi-docgen (2021.5+ds1-1) experimental; urgency=medium

  * Initial packaging (Closes: #987000).
    Note that this package should not be used in build-dependencies
    until it is considered stable upstream.
    - Disable fonts used upstream until they are packaged separately
      (see RFP #736681, #986999)

 -- Simon McVittie <smcv@debian.org>  Thu, 15 Apr 2021 23:40:51 +0100
